A train trip from Barry Docks to Swanley takes about 4hrs 8 mins on average, covering roughly 148 miles (238 kilometres). With around 26 trains running each day, there's plenty of flexibility for your travel plans. If you book in advance, you can grab tickets starting from just £27.50, making it a budget-friendly option for those who plan ahead.

Barry Docks Station is a charming and practical stop in the Vale of Glamorgan, serving the vibrant town of Barry and its surrounds. It invites both locals and travelers to explore the distinct charm of South Wales. While its modest setup might not offer an abundance of facilities, it effectively caters to commuters and visitors looking to embark on their journey or explore the nearby attractions. Whether you're catching a train to work or embarking on an exciting adventure, Barry Docks ensures a fuss-free experience.
The station is streamlined for efficiency, despite not housing a ticket office. Travelers can easily collect or purchase their tickets from the convenient machines, accessible through major debit and credit cards. While the station might lack first-class lounges, and certain luxuries like refreshment facilities and toilets, it makes up for it with essential amenities designed for ease of use. Step-free access is available, although it’s recommended to plan ahead addressing any mobility constraints, considering the steep ramp on premises.
Whether you're a first-timer or a seasoned rail traveler, Barry Docks offers practical resources. Although direct human assistance onboard the station is absent, informative help points, and screens for arrivals and departements keep you updated. Assistance for those who might need a helping hand while traveling can be arranged through the Passenger Assist service, enhancing your overall travel experience.

Swanley Train Station offers a range of facilities to make your journey as smooth and hassle-free as possible. The ticket office is open throughout the week, equipped with ticket machines including options for online purchases. Accessibility is a priority, with step-free access available via the main entrance from Station Approach Road and lifts to all platforms. It is worth noting that step-free access is limited on the Everest Place side, but provisions such as a ramp for train access and accessible toilets are in place to help those with mobility challenges.
If you require assistance, staff are on hand across the week from early mornings to late evening. The station holds a Secure Station accreditation, ensuring a safe and secure environment for all passengers. For additional comfort, seating areas are available even though there are no waiting rooms. Meanwhile, refreshment kiosks and smartcard services ensure you have all you need for your travel.

Trains from Swanley make it easy to visit London, connecting you to major city destinations such as London Victoria, London Bridge, and the iconic London Charing Cross. The journey options don’t stop there; consider heading to rustic and historical towns like Rochester and Sevenoaks.
Swanley also offers direct trains to Maidstone East and Chatham, making it ideal for both leisure trips and regular commutes. With such amazing places within easy reach, Swanley Train Station truly serves as your launchpad to adventure.
